Rock Cycle and Natural Resources Eggspert Review Game Rock Cycle and Natural Resources

Create a T-Chart in your warm up section of your NB and place the following resources under the correct category, Renewableor Non-Renewable.Solar, Hydroelectric, Geothermal, Coal, Wind, Oil, Natural Gas, Nuclear, Biomass, Petroleum, Fossil Fuels, Propane.

What kind of energy comes from heat inside the Earth? #1 What kind of energy comes from heat inside the Earth?

What kind of energy comes from heat inside the Earth? #1 Answer What kind of energy comes from heat inside the Earth? Answer: Geothermal Energy

True or False: Geothermal energy is non-renewable. #2 True or False: Geothermal energy is non-renewable.

True or False: Geothermal energy is non-renewable. #2 Answer True or False: Geothermal energy is non-renewable. Answer: False, geothermal energy is renewable.

#3 A natural resource that can be replaced at the same rate at which it is consumed is:___________________

#3 Answer A natural resource that can be replaced at the same rate at which it is consumed is: renewable.

Where is geothermal energy found? #4 Where is geothermal energy found?

Where is geothermal energy found? Answer: deep underground

Which type of rock is formed from heat and pressure? #5 Which type of rock is formed from heat and pressure?

Which type of rock is formed from heat and pressure? #5 Answer Which type of rock is formed from heat and pressure? Answer: Metamorphic

#6 What processes are necessary to change a metamorphic rock into a sedimentary rock?

#6 Answer What processes are necessary to change a metamorphic rock into a sedimentary rock? Answer: WEDCC Weathering, erosion, deposition, compaction, cementation

Must include BOTH reasons. #7 (Double) Why do humans continue to use fossil fuels, even though they have numerous drawbacks, including causing pollution? Must include BOTH reasons.

#7 Answer (Double) Why do humans continue to use fossil fuels, even though they have numerous drawbacks, including causing pollution? Must include BOTH reasons. Answer: Fossil fuels generate more power than alternative resources and are cheaper.

#8 What process are necessary to change an igneous rock to a metamorphic rock, and then to a sedimentary rock? Must include both processes.

#8 Answer What process are necessary to change an igneous rock to a metamorphic rock, and then to a sedimentary rock? Answer: 1. heat and pressure, then: 2. WEDCC (weathering, erosion, deposition, compaction, cementation)

#9 A natural resources that cannot be replaced at the same rate at which it is consumed is ________________.

#9 Answer A natural resources that cannot be replaced at the same rate at which it is consumed is non-renewable.

#10 This type of sedimentary rock usually forms in swampy areas with decayed plant matter.

#10 Answer This type of sedimentary rock usually forms in swampy areas with decayed plant matter. Answer: organic

#11 What formation process is required to change any rock into an igneous rock?

Answer: melting, cooling, and solidifying What formation process is required to change any rock into an igneous rock? Answer: melting, cooling, and solidifying

The Chernobyl incident was caused by which energy resource? #12 The Chernobyl incident was caused by which energy resource?

The Chernobyl incident was caused by which energy resource? #12 Answer The Chernobyl incident was caused by which energy resource? Answer: Nuclear Energy (Uranium)

True or false: nuclear energy is non- renewable #13 True or false: nuclear energy is non- renewable

True or false: nuclear energy is non- renewable Answer: True

Which energy resources comes from burning organic matter? #14 Which energy resources comes from burning organic matter?

Which energy resources comes from burning organic matter? #14 Answer Which energy resources comes from burning organic matter? Answer: Biomass

True or false: biomass is a renewable energy resource. #15 True or false: biomass is a renewable energy resource.

True or false: biomass is a renewable energy resource. Answer: True

List all five non-renewable energy resources. #16 (Double) List all five non-renewable energy resources.

List all five non-renewable energy resources. Answer: 1. coal #16 (Double) Answer List all five non-renewable energy resources. Answer: 1. coal 2. oil/petroleum 3. natural gas 4. nuclear 5. propane

List all five renewable energy resources. #17 (Double) List all five renewable energy resources.

List all five renewable energy resources. Answer: 1. solar #17 (Double) Answer List all five renewable energy resources. Answer: 1. solar 2. hydroelectric 3. geothermal 4. wind 5. biomass
